There are plenty of ironies herehow about the fact that Signal is part-backed by WhatsApp founder Brian Acton, or that WhatsApp’s fabled end-to-end encryption is actually Signal’s own protocol. Founded in July 2014, Signal has more than 40 million monthly users, in part driven by a surge of new users in January 2021 when Meta-owned WhatsApp enacted a controversial policy change that sparked a privacy backlash over the nature of personal information shared with its parent company.īut the communication app's rapid growth has had its share of downsides, what with the company's employees raising concerns about the fallout stemming from potential misuse of the service by malicious actors, which could add ammunition to ongoing debates about weakening encryption protections to facilitate law enforcement investigations.Ĭomplicating matters further is its decision to integrate MobileCoin, purportedly an "encrypted-focused cryptocurrency" into the app to facilitate peer-to-peer payments, a shift that could potentially put private messaging at risk by not only attracting regulatory scrutiny but could also serve as an open invitation for criminals to exploit the platform to their benefit.
